A bathtub can hold 80 gallons of water. The faucet flows at a rate of 4 gallons per minute. What percentage of the tub will be f illed after 6 minutes.
2 answers:
In 6 minutes, the bathtub will have 24 gallons of water in it. To find how much percentage of the tub this is, you have to divide it by 80. 24/80 is 0.3. 0.3 is 30 percent. So, after 6 minutes, the tub will be 30% filled.
